About 2-(2-methylpropyl)oxolane

2-(2-methylpropyl)oxolane (PubChem CID 14242113) has the molecular formula C8H16O and a molecular weight of 128.21 g/mol. Its IUPAC name is 2-(2-methylpropyl)oxolane.
